GROSSMAN, M.D., Gilbert "Gil" D.

Gilbert David Grossman, M.D., of Asheville, NC, passed away Thursday, September 25, 2025.

Gil was largely raised in Maplewood, NJ but made his way south in his late teens. He went on to receive his BS from Davidson College in 1958, with a Doctor of Medicine from Emory University in 1962. Gil continued with specialized training at both Georgetown University and University of California San Diego (Pulmonary Medicine), was accorded numerous academic appointments; he also served in the U.S. Air Force as a Medical Officer (Captain).

It was at Emory that Gil met and married Jane David. Their 'neverending love story' culminated in four children and four grandchildren. Gil and Jane considered Atlanta their hometown, but retired to their beloved mountain home Asheville, NC in 2010.

In addition to an illustrious career and raising his family, Gil was active in his community, serving on the Institutional Review Board and Medical Ethics Committee of Mission Health & Hospitals of Asheville.

But for all who knew Gil, he loved happy hour, was a great storyteller ... and never found a blue blazer he didn't like. He and Jane absolutely loved spending their retirement years traveling extensively through Europe, indulging in their love of music as well as Jane's special interest in collecting Carolina folk pottery.

He is survived by a family that adored him: daughter, Leslie Jeffords; son, G. David Grossman, Jr. and wife, Letitia, with granddaughters, Margaret and Sarah; daughter, Marion G. Mande and husband, Christian Mande; daughter Caroline G. Brown and husband, Michael Brown; with grandsons, William and Matthew. A private service will be held with immediate family.

For those that are moved to do so, the family asks that donations be made to any of the following organizations that had personal meaning to Gil: The Parkinson's Foundation parkinson.org, Givens Estates Resident Assistance Ministry givensestates.org/donate-giving-opportunities or the Emory University School of Medicine med.emory.edu/giving.

I had the good fortune to work with Dr. Gil Grossman while serving as an administrator at Crawford Long Hospital where Gil practiced for more than 40 years. I first met Gil in March 1975 when he was caring for my mother in the hospital's 31 ICU. He was so kind and caring for all of her family as we dealt with her decline and death. A decade later, Gil joined the hospital's ethics committee on which I also served. He was and exceptionally thoughtful and gifted counselor whenever ethics issues arose. I find it not surprising that Gil joined the ethics committee in the hospital in Asheville following his retirement.
Speaking for myself and his many colleagues and friends from Crawford Long, he will be missed by all who knew and worked withhim.
